The AAIP course full form is Arena Animation International Program. Animation is no longer just Saturday morning cartoons; it’s a booming industry encompassing movies, games, advertising, and more. For aspiring artists with a passion for bringing visuals to life, the Arena Animation International Program (AAIP) offers a comprehensive gateway into this exciting realm. What is the AAIP Course About?

AAIP students study 2D and 3D animation in a comprehensive curriculum to succeed in the animation industry. Participants learn to write captivating characters and vivid scenes. Character design and storytelling are taught in 2D animation utilizing Toon Boom Harmony and hand-drawn methods. Professional 3D modeling, rigging, animation, and visual effects software like Maya or 3ds Max helps participants create complex animated worlds. Digital painting and texturing enhance 3D realism, while concept art and storyboarding help students tell tales. Students develop character depth and individuality by studying animation ideas and acting for animators.

Eligibility Criteria:

Graduates of Class 12 are invited to the Advanced Animation Program. Some institutions have minimal grades or prioritize high school students who studied certain subjects. Success in this sector requires artistic talent, a creative approach, and solid computer skills. AAIP candidates should be innovative since animation is visual and original. Sketching, design, and storytelling skills assist produce engaging animations and characters. This involves computer skills as animation employs software and tools to visualize digital concepts. Future Scope:

The Advanced Animation Program (AAIP) graduates have several exciting animation jobs that fit their skills and interests. AAIP graduates may become commercial, instructional, or 2D animators. They may work as 3D Animators on movie, game, and architectural character modeling, animation, and visual effects. Characters, places, and objects created by concept artists aid animation visualization. Storyboard artists provide detailed animation project storyboards to aid development. Game animators bring characters to life, produce realistic gestures, and enhance gameplay.

Salary:

Experience, expertise, location, and project type impact animation pay. Entry-level animators in India earn Rs.2-3 lakhs, according to Animation World Network. Animators may earn more as they get experience, specialize in 2D or 3D animation, and establish a portfolio. Feature films, TV, advertisements, and video games may also effect an animator’s salary.
